Ryan Fennelly of La Salle (St. Puis) ran a NCAA provisional qualifying time of 8:05.45 in the 3k in Boston at the Terrier Invitational at Boston University this past weekend. Also this weekend, his former HS teammate Tom Parlapiano, a senior at Villanova University, competed at the Boston Indoor Games, anchoring the team\'s DMR to an NCAA auto time of 9:34. His split for 1600 was an impressive 3:58.
At the Armory in a meet hosted by Columbia and Princeton, Adam Breisch (Quakertown) ran 4:12.82 in the mile for 6th. Tim Carroll (Springfield, Montco) ran 4:12.26 for 5th, and Pat Nash (O\'Hara) got 4th with a 4:11.44. All IC4A qualifying times. Earlier this season, Nash ran 2:24.32 for 1000m, which is 2nd in the country. In the 3k at the Armory meet, John Butler, Cedar Cliff, took 2nd with a time of 8:30.63.
